Motaz Malhees is a Palestinian actor who is currently newsworthy because he is unable to attend the Academy Awards due to a travel ban imposed by the Trump administration. He stars in 'The Voice of Hind Rajab,' a film nominated for Best International Feature Film. The film centers on the story of a five-year-old Palestinian girl killed by Israeli forces in Gaza in 2024. Malhees plays the role of a call center operator in the movie. His inability to attend the Oscars highlights the impact of US travel restrictions on artists and filmmakers, particularly those from Palestine, and raises questions about cultural exchange and representation on international platforms.
